Darren Waller focusing on how Raiders can improve

Las Vegas Raiders tight end Darren Waller said there are a lot of areas where he and the team can improve following Sunday's 45-20, Week 7 loss to the Tampa Bay Buccaneers.

What It Means:

Waller caught 6 passes for 50 yards and a touchdown on 9 targets on Sunday. He led the Raiders in catches and tied Nelson Agholor for the team-lead in targets. Waller is pacing all tight ends in the league in targets (9.3) and receptions (6.7) per game. He will remain a top option for Derek Carr in Week 8 when the Raiders face the Cleveland Browns.

Waller scored 14.0 FanDuel points in Week 7 and is averaging 11.8 FanDuel points per game (TE3). He has the fourth-lowest average depth of target (5.8 yards) among any tight end with at least 20 targets this season. The Browns have allowed the fifth-most receptions (40) to opposing tight ends this season.
